September 22, 2024<\/strong>&nbsp;\u2013 Although the Dominican Republic has made economic progress, challenges still exist in some communities, especially regarding access to economic opportunities for women entrepreneurs. Limited access to appropriate technologies and training remains an area for improvement to foster more inclusive and sustainable development in the country.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">In this context,<strong>&nbsp;The Trust for the Americas<\/strong>, a non-profit organization affiliated with the&nbsp;<strong>American States (OAS) internship program<\/strong>, has been a key player in the implementation of innovative solutions seeking to transform the most vulnerable communities in the Dominican Republic. In collaboration with&nbsp;<strong>AES Dominican Republic Foundation<\/strong>&nbsp;and with the support of<strong>&nbsp;OAS<\/strong>, The Trust has created synergies that, since 2019, have directly impacted nearly<strong>&nbsp;500 people<\/strong>, of which&nbsp;<strong>90 % are women<\/strong>&nbsp;in areas such as Boca Chica, Guayacanes, La Caleta, Los Mina, Quisqueya, and more recently, in San Antonio de Guerra.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Through its training programs in entrepreneurship, digital technology, and social-emotional skills, The Trust has equipped these communities with the tools they need to improve their businesses and raise their families\u2019 quality of life. Some of these training sessions were held at the&nbsp;<strong>San Antonio de Guerra Community Technology Center (CTC)<\/strong>, one of the&nbsp;<strong>more than 100 centers<\/strong>&nbsp;that The Trust operates in partnership with the Community Technology Centers of the Office of the President of the Dominican Republic.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">As part of this effort, the Entrepreneurship Fair was held on September 22, during which The Trust, in collaboration with the AES Dominicana Foundation, provided&nbsp;<strong>40 female entrepreneurs<\/strong>&nbsp;the opportunity to present your products and services to leaders of the business ecosystem, generating new growth and expansion opportunities for your businesses.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Esteban de la Torre, representative of the OAS in the Dominican Republic, highlighted:&nbsp;<em>\u201cThe OAS\u2019s collaboration with The Trust for the Americas and the AES Dominicana Foundation is a clear example of how strategic partnerships can transform economic development in vulnerable communities.
